Game Design Document (GDD) Template

Instructions: This document outlines the full design of your escape room — from player flow and mechanics to aesthetics and tech. It should evolve alongside your project and guide your build and testing efforts.


Team Name:

Escape Room Title:


1. Game Overview

  • One-paragraph summary of the room’s concept and story.
  • Target audience and intended emotional experience.

2. Puzzle Flow / Progression Map

  • List puzzles in the order players encounter them.
  • Indicate whether puzzles are linear or parallel.
  • Note dependencies between puzzles or bottlenecks.

Include a visual flowchart or puzzle dependency graph if possible.


3. Core Mechanics & Interactions

  • Describe how players will interact with the room (searching, combining, manipulating, decoding, etc.)
  • What kinds of inputs and outputs are expected (e.g., keypads, RFID triggers, magnets, logic circuits)?

4. Narrative Integration

  • How does the story evolve during the game?
  • How are puzzles and props connected to the story?
  • What environmental storytelling elements are present?

5. Technology and Tools Used

  • What microcontrollers, sensors, or software are involved (if any)?
  • Describe any tools or platforms used for prototyping (Arduino, Unity, etc.)

6. Room Layout and Set Design

  • Sketch or describe the physical space (rooms, zones, furniture, barriers)
  • How do players move through the space?
  • Any lighting, sound, or prop effects to enhance immersion?

7. User Experience & Flow

  • What is the expected player journey (emotional arc)?
  • What is the average time to complete the room?
  • Where are the moments of tension, relief, revelation?

8. Reset and Maintenance Plan

  • How long does it take to reset the room?
  • Who can do it? Is special training needed?
  • Are there durable or fragile components that need attention?
